1 x Headlight High Bean fault
 
Hi, I have a '02 Cooper. I had a faulty lighting switch which was causing some erratic light functions. I replaced the light stalk & now all functions are correct. However, on the driver's side (RH drive) the full beam does not illuminate. The bulb is good. When I had the issues with the stalk, both full beams would illuminate when I used the indicators (when lights were in off position), but I had to switch the lights on & off to quench. I thought the stalk was at fault which I exchanged & it has sorted everything else except this one bulb that won't go onto heads. I've noticed quite a number of R50's driving around that have the same bulb out. Is there a known fault & cure?A point in the right direction would be appreciated.
